Why Cheval’s Climate & Housing Affect Windows & Doors
Cheval sits inside Hillsborough County’s wind-borne debris zone. That means every replacement window and door you install must meet Florida Building Code impact-resistance standards or be paired with approved hurricane protection. It’s a meaningful code upgrade from the builder-grade aluminum frames that went in during the community’s late-1990s and early-2000s buildout, and a contractor who tries to sell you a “simple swap” without mentioning it is not doing you any favors. We explain the wind-zone requirements upfront, quote the compliant product, and handle the permit paperwork. It’s just how the job gets done here.
The housing stock itself drives a different kind of demand. Cheval homes are large upscale stucco with tile roofs, generous window counts, soaring two-story entry glass, and oversized sliding doors opening to screened pool enclosures. That means replacement jobs routinely involve more openings, larger custom sizes, and heavier structural glass than a tract neighborhood of the same era would need. The 12 to 16 foot wide sliders on the pool lanais, in particular, show chronic track corrosion and failed weatherstripping from decades of Florida humidity and pool-chemical air. A lot of general window shops in the Tampa market decline to quote those because they’re heavy and finicky. We quote them, order them, and install them correctly.
Pricing for Windows & Doors in Cheval
What should you expect to pay in Cheval? Honest numbers, based on what we’ve quoted across 33558 lately. Standard impact windows run $900 to $2,400 per opening installed, depending on size and design pressure. Non-impact energy-efficient windows start around $600 per opening. Front entry doors range from $1,200 to $4,500 depending on material and impact rating. The big sliding glass door replacements, the 12 to 16 foot lanai openings, typically land between $3,500 and $8,000 installed. Custom geometric windows are quoted per shape and size; there’s no flat rate on a trapezoid. Florida Pays Cheval Homeowners Back
There are real incentives on the table for Cheval homeowners right now. My Safe Florida Home matching grants cover up to $10,000 for qualifying wind-mitigation upgrades on a primary residence, and impact windows and doors qualify. Florida also exempts impact-resistant windows and doors from sales tax, which on a $40,000 whole-home job is a four-figure savings. The federal 25C energy credit returns 30 percent of product cost on qualifying energy-efficient units, up to $600 per year. And after a wind-mitigation inspection (typically $75 to $150), most Cheval homeowners see their windstorm premium drop around 25 percent on the windstorm portion of the policy. We can’t guarantee what your carrier will do, but the programs and credits are real, and we’ll point you to the right paperwork.
One thing worth knowing before you decide: impact windows beat hurricane shutters for a simple reason. Shutters only protect you when someone is home to hang them, and they protect nothing the other 364 days of the year. Impact glass is permanent protection on every window, every day, with no panels to drag out of the garage. Cheval homeowners who spend their summers traveling don’t have to worry about a storm rolling through while they’re out of town and the shutters are still stacked in the garage. The glass does the work.
